How To Choose The Right Easter Outfit For Your Child

A holiday outfit needs to pull double duty: it has to look wonderful for photos and family, and survive the actual day your child puts it through. Here’s what to consider:

1. Think Beyond Easter Sunday

Look for styles in fresh spring colours (pastels, soft brights) that work for school, birthday parties, and casual outings. All five picks in this list are multi-occasion by design.

2. Prioritise Fabric and Comfort

Children won’t sit still in uncomfortable clothes — and they’ll tell you about it loudly. Look for breathable fabrics (mesh, soft cotton blends, moisture-wicking weaves) and construction that allows movement: elastic waists, flowy silhouettes, and flexible leotard bases.

3. Consider the Weather and the Schedule

Easter Sunday in most parts of the country can range from crisp morning to warm afternoon. Layering-friendly outfits (like the tulle dress worn over a long-sleeve top in the morning) give you flexibility without needing a full wardrobe change.
